Greenwood obviously has its downsides, but I’ve lived here for 15+ years and still think it’s one of the better values in Seattle.
I’ve considered moving neighborhoods, but you get more space here, a real neighborhood feel, easy access to Phinney, Ballard, north Fremont, accessible walking, jogging, or biking. A 10-minute bike ride or 20-minute walk puts you in neighborhoods that are pretty cost-prohibitive for a lot of people. The 5 takes you all the way down to SODO and the northgate light rail is close-ish.
It’s not perfect, but for the price and space, I think Greenwood is tough to beat if you want a city feel and want space.
